Dimitri is buying a camera on an installment plan. He makes equal monthly payments. The equation below can be used to find the amount he owes after any number of months of payments.
y=−25x+400
What does the number 400 represent in the equation?
Step-by-step explanation: It is in slope-intercept form. y=mx+b. My comment earlier was incorrect. m is how much money he has to pay every month, and b is how much he initially owes.
